
GWENDOLYN PICCOLA
Obituary
Gwendolyn Earlene Beezley Piccola was born November 10, 1927 to George Albert Beezley, and Beatrice White in Celeste, Texas. After graduating high school, Gwen moved to Dallas, Texas. She began her adult life working various jobs, and started her life’s calling as a mother. Gwen worked at Safeway grocery, and Texas Instruments while simultaneously raising her four children. While working at Safeway, she met and married the love of her life, Luke Piccola. Gwen and Luke had 3 children together. Gwen lost Luke on April 24, 1975. She continued to raise their 3 children aged 12, 9, and 7, all while working nights at Texas Instruments. Gwen retired in 1992 after 20 years with Texas Instruments. During her retirement, Gwen helped several people who needed assistance in their elder years, all while helping to raise her grandchildren, and great grandchildren. Gwen was a shining example of grace, character, and class. She left this world to be with Luke Piccola on June 8, 2022.
Gwen was preceded in death by her husband Luke, granddaughter Tiffany Ulmer, and stepson Luke Piccola. She is survived by her children, David Bullock, stepson Chris Piccola and wife Nita, and their son Chris Jr., Frank Piccola, Lori Alexander and husband Lonny, Gena Hollowell and her husband Greg. Grandchildren Tasha Hammond and her husband Matt. Dale Roberson and his wife Sharon. Jerry Ulmer, and Brittany Ulmer. Great grandchildren Noah Yancey, Joseph Hammond, Ryley Ulmer, Travis Roberson, and Luke Roberson.
